Output 64be54b5d271b3094e0d0a42c06f37da4861109da5940cfaa2eff0c160bb00bf:0

value
4147093966
script pubkey
OP_0 OP_PUSHBYTES_20 16ff2c744c93b0fa0f8fa56fb81a1963550fcff7
address
tb1qzmljcazvjwc05ru054hmsxsevd2slnlhwy70hp
transaction
64be54b5d271b3094e0d0a42c06f37da4861109da5940cfaa2eff0c160bb00bf
confirmations
106296
spent
true